Finance Review Summary — Brindlecote Outfitters. Sales leads: our liability and cargo policies renew next quarter. Premiums are projected up 12% on claims history; the cargo line is the driver. We are quoting alternatives through two brokers and may raise deductibles to hold cost flat. Budget guidance is unchanged for now. Further direction appears in the confidential note below.

confidential, kagup-bafog: Fraaxax Group is in early talks to buy Soroxox Group for about $343.8 million. The Olidor launch date is June 14, and nothing goes to the press before then. Legal wants the Aldmirek Logistics term sheet signed before July 23.

## Runbook: Gaugepile Sidecar — Release Checklist

Heads up: the sidecar ships with every app pod, so a bad config fans out fast. Before cutting a release, confirm the flush interval hasn't drifted from what the Tallyhouse aggregator expects, or you'll see sawtooth gaps in dashboards. Rollbacks are cheap — just repin the image tag. Canary one node pool first, watch for ten minutes, then proceed. The values to verify against are these.

config for bagep-yafof:
quenath:
  pin: 8584
  metrics_host: metrics.quenath.tolvaqsys.internal
  tenant: pelath
  seal: seal_ed102645

Ticket: Vault lockout blocking bulk-edit fixes (for weekly sync)

The Marloe admin table's bulk-edit feature still double-applies status changes when rows are filtered. Fix is ready, but the config vault holding the staging credentials locked itself after three bad attempts (my fault, wrong keyboard layout). Ops says anyone on the team can reopen it with the shared recovery passphrase, so posting it here for the sync.

vault phrase of tajop-haduf = holath-brivan-wenax

14:22 — Velsin formula sandbox bypassed via nested import in user-supplied expressions. Detection: anomaly alert on evaluator CPU. Action: disabled custom formulas tenant-wide, rolled evaluator back one version. Impact: three tenants, read-only exposure, no data written. Patch validated in staging by 15:10. Release manager: hold the pending train until the hardened build clears canary. Reference token follows.

pipeline stamp: htk9_ce63042d9